Cisco IOS MPLS Management Technology Overview - · PDF fileCisco IOS® MPLS Management...

Preview:

Citation preview

1© 2004 Cisco Systems, Inc. All rights reserved.

Cisco IOS® MPLS ManagementTechnology Overview

Enabling Innovative Services

February 2004

222© 2004 Cisco Systems, Inc. All rights reserved.

Agenda

• IntroductionProblems, challenges, requirements

• Technology Overview• Summary

3© 2004 Cisco Systems, Inc. All rights reserved.

Service Provider Problems

• Operational EfficienciesIncrease management automation and availability

• New Services ProvisioningEnable competitive differentiation and customer retentionthrough profitable bundled services

• Disparate NetworksManage and consolidate traditional and emerging networks

OSS

OSS

TDM

FR, ATM

TDM

FR, ATM

IP

OSSOSS

OSS

IP

MPLS

TDM FR, ATMOSS

444© 2004 Cisco Systems, Inc. All rights reserved.

MPLS Service Provisioning Challenge

10%

Integration with OSS and Billing System

Number of Network Elements Involved

Integrating MultipleTechnologies into a Single Service

Finding CustomerSelf-Provisioning Tools that Work

Equipment Manufacturer ManagementSystem Not Designed for Provisioning

Interoperability Among Products

Manual Configuration of Equipment 18%

Challenges in VPN Service ProvisioningChallenges in VPN Service Provisioning

20% 30% 40% 50% 60%

35%

41%

41%

47%

47%

65%

Source: Infonetics, 2003

555© 2004 Cisco Systems, Inc. All rights reserved.

Reducing OpEx with Network Management• CapEx typically follows

the economy• OpEx is consistent

• Typical ratio of a Tier 1 carrierCapEx vs OpEx spending

• OpEx efficiencies have higherprofitability and a higher ARPU

Source: Frost and Sullivan, 2002

27%

73%

CapitalExpenditureOperationalExpense

$ B

illio

ns

Quarterly Spending

$0.0

$1.0

$2.0

$3.0

$4.0

$5.0

$6.0

$7.0

$8.0

$9.0

Q1 Q2 Q3 Q4

CapitalExpenditureOperations &SupportExpense

666© 2004 Cisco Systems, Inc. All rights reserved.

Customer Requirements

• Provide systemic management solutions for achieving dramaticproductivity gains through automation, intelligence, andsimplification

• Enable competitive differentiation and customer retention throughhigh-margin, bundled services

Provide automated embedded toolsConfigurationError detection & recoveryPerformance and accounting

• Perform data plane validation with respect to control planeData plane liveliness and troubleshooting

• Standards and open interfaces, APIs to management/OSSapplications and third-party software vendors

• End-to-end circuit/service-level health/alarm correlation

666© 2004 Cisco Systems, Inc. All rights reserved.

777© 2004 Cisco Systems, Inc. All rights reserved.

Agenda

• Introduction• Technology Overview• Summary

888© 2004 Cisco Systems, Inc. All rights reserved.

Info Server VPN PolicyManager

Cisco Info Center

Cisco® IPSolution Center

EMSEMS

CNS PerformanceEngine

NetFlowCollector

ISV PartnersOSS

IngressPE

CECE EgressPE

ProcessNetworkAlarms

DetermineService Impact

• VPN Topology• Service Provisioning

Device/Network Provisioning

MPLS Management Life Cycle

MPLS OAM

End-End OAMAttachment VC OAM’s Attachment VC OAM’s

PWE3 orVPN Label

LSP created by LDP and/or RSVP-TE

Fault PerformanceAccounting

9

MPLSEmbedded

Management

MPLS Management Architecture

FaultFault ConfigurationConfiguration Performance Performance & Accounting& Accounting

ElementElementManagementManagementSystemSystem

• Alarm Notification• Alarm

Synchronisation• Threshold Alerts• Dagnostic

MonitoringSNMP Get,getBulk, TrapsSyslogs

• RMON

• Config Upload• Incremental

Configuration• Change

NotificationProgrammaticInterfaceCLITFTP

• Data Collection• Data Export

SNMP Getand GetBulkBulk filetransferNetflow

Operations SupportOperations SupportSystem (OSS)System (OSS)

Software PartnersSoftware PartnersGUI

• CORBA• SNMP• TL1• XML

TelnetTelnetSSHSSH

CNS BusCNS BusHTTPHTTPSNMPSNMP

NetFlowNetFlow

Cisco IOS Software

MPLSFCAPS

SNMPXML

CLI

MIBs

LSP PingTraceroute

VCCV Protocol Enhancements

AutoTunnelAutoMEshSecurity

AccountingNetFlow

PerformanceSAA

InfrastructureEnhancements

Cisco IOSProgrammatic

Interface

101010© 2004 Cisco Systems, Inc. All rights reserved.

MPLS LSP Ping/Traceroute

• Draft-ietf-mpls-lsp-ping-xx.txtIETF StandardsIETF Standards

• IPv4 LDP prefix• TE tunnel• MPLS PE, P connectivity for MPLS transport, MPLS VPN, MPLS TE

applications

ApplicationsApplications

• MPLS LSP Ping (ICMP) for connectivity checks• MPLS LSP Traceroute for hop-by-hop fault localization• MPLS LSP Traceroute for path tracing

SolutionSolution

• Detect MPLS traffic black holes or misrouting• Isolate MPLS faults• Verify data plane against the control plane• Detect MTU of MPLS LSP paths

RequirementRequirement

111111© 2004 Cisco Systems, Inc. All rights reserved.

LSP Ping/Traceroute Example

Originatingrouter

Targetrouter

MPLS Echo Request

MPLS Echo Reply

TTL=1 Targetrouter

MPLS Echo Reply

1

2

3 4

9

5

6 7 8

TTL=2

TTL=3

Ping

Traceroute

121212© 2004 Cisco Systems, Inc. All rights reserved.

MPLS AToM Virtual CircuitConnection Verification ( VCCV)

• Draft-ietf-pwe3-vccv-xx.txtIETF StandardsIETF Standards

• Layer 2 transport over MPLSFRoMPLS, ATMoMPLS, EoMPLS

ApplicationsApplications

• AToM VCCV allows sending control packets in band of an AToMpseudowire. Two components:

Signaled component to communicate VCCV capabilities as partof VC labelSwitching component to cause the AToM VC payload to be treated as acontrol packet

Type 1: uses Protocol ID of AToM Control wordType 2: use MPLS router alert label

SolutionSolution

• Ability to provide end-to-end fault detection and diagnostics for anemulated pseudowire service

One tunnel can serve many pseudowires.MPLS LSP ping is sufficient to monitor the PSN tunnel (PE-PEconnectivity), but not VCs inside of tunnel

RequirementRequirement

131313© 2004 Cisco Systems, Inc. All rights reserved.

VCCV Example

Attachment VCLSP Tunnel

LSP PseudowirePing

Attachment VCs

141414© 2004 Cisco Systems, Inc. All rights reserved.

MPLS Traffic Engineering: AutoTunnel –Primary, Backup, & Mesh Groups

• draft-ietf-mpls-rsvp-lsp-fastreroute-03.txt• draft-ietf-ospf-cap-01.txt• draft-vasseur-mpls-ospf-te-cap-xx.txt

IETF StandardsIETF Standards

• MPLS VPN with multiservice SLAs (voice, video, and data sites)• MPLS AToM-based Layer 2 services with “Bandwidth Assurances”• Enhanced SLA service offerings with low packet loss during failure

condition – “Bandwidth Protection”

ApplicationsApplications

• Backup AutoTunnel—Enables a router to dynamically buildbackup tunnels

• Primary one-hop AutoTunnel—Enables a router to dynamicallycreate one-hop primary tunnels on all interfaces that have beenenabled with MPLS TE tunnels

• Mesh Group AutoTunnel – Enables automatic establishment of full-or partial-mesh of TE tunnels

SolutionSolution

• Ability to protect links and nodes with no requirement of “trafficengineering”

• Need to ease configuration of “increased bandwidth inventory”MPLS TE designs such as full mesh

RequirementRequirement

151515© 2004 Cisco Systems, Inc. All rights reserved.

MPLS Traffic EngineeringAutoTunnel – Primary & Backup

Router A

Router C

Router B

Router A establishes AutoTunnels to adjacent routers –“automates” configuration of Link & Node Protection

Router D

Backup AutoTunnel – NextHop – “Link Protection”

AutoTunnel Backup NextNext Hop – “NodeProtection”

AutoTunnelPrimary

Router configured with AutoTunnel Primary & Backup

Manually configured Tunnels take precedence over AutoTunnels –provides “tweaking” capability for customers

161616© 2004 Cisco Systems, Inc. All rights reserved.

MPLS Traffic EngineeringAutoTunnel – Mesh Groups

Service ProviderBackbone

AutoTunnels belonging to “Mesh Group 1”

Partial Mesh of Physical Connectivity

Routers A, B, C, D, E – defined as members of “Mesh Group 1”Capable of building multiple meshes for DiffServ aware Traffic EngineeringAutomates configuration of full mesh of TE Tunnels resulting in operational efficiencies

Router A

Router B Router C

Router D

Router E

171717© 2004 Cisco Systems, Inc. All rights reserved.

MPLS-Aware SAA

• RFC 1889 Jitter Compliant metricsIETF StandardsIETF Standards

• MPLS, MPLS-VPN, MPLS-TEApplicationsApplications

• Active traffic generation within Cisco IOS using SAA• Jitter, packet loss, latency, connectivity• CPE to CPE, PE to CE, and PE to PE measurements• SAA PE, multi-vrf CE or dedicated SAA router

SolutionSolution

• IP SLA monitoring for MPLS VPNs• Network performance monitoring per VPN• Hop-by-hop statistics for troubleshooting• Low-cost solution embedded in Cisco IOS® Software

RequirementRequirement

18© 2004 Cisco Systems, Inc. All rights reserved.

SAA VPN Measurements

Cisco IP SolutionCenter

Partner ReportingApplications

PEPE

CE

CE

CE

Blue VPN site 3

Blue VPN site 1

Blue VPN site 2

SAA

SAA

SAACE

Red VPN site 1

SAA

CE

Red VPN site 2

SAA

PE PE

Dedicated SAA Router

Dedicated SAA Router

Blue VPN SAAMeasurements

CNS PerformanceEngine 2.1

SAA MIB DataSAA MIB Data

Per VPN Performance MonitoringPacket loss, Latency, Jitter, Connectivity

• PE to PE, CE to CE, PE to CE, PE to remote CE

Cisco® InfoCenter

191919© 2004 Cisco Systems, Inc. All rights reserved.

MPLS-Aware NetFlow

• IPFIX WG proposed standardIETF StandardsIETF Standards

• MPLS, MPLS-VPN, MPLS-TEApplicationsApplications

• Cisco IOS MPLS-Aware NetFlowNetFlow version 9Label export with destination prefixPer Label accounting aggregation

• CNS NetFlow Collector 5.0Support of EXP bits as a field to key flow reports onUsing NFC 5.0 + add on PE-PE Traffic matrix module provides PE-PEtraffic matrix aggregation

SolutionSolution

• MPLS network capacity planning• PE to PE traffic matrix• Per-VPN MPLS accounting• IP flow analysis

RequirementRequirement

202020© 2004 Cisco Systems, Inc. All rights reserved.

MPLS-Aware NetFlowMPLS-Aware NetFlow (version 9)

• Exports up to three MPLS labels,and IP packet information

• Ideal for Traffic Engineering andcapacity planning

MPLS

Traditional NetFlow for IP to MPLS traffic

PEPE PP PEPE

Traffic Flow

IP

IP

Egress MPLS NetFlow Accountingfor MPLS to IP traffic

MPLS-Aware NetFlow (version 9)

Performance Datavia FTP

NetFlow Collector (NFC)

CNS FCAPSPerfE: NFC VPN Accounting Module (PE-PE)

Partner Reporting

Applications

Aggreg. Netflow Data

XMLConfig control

SAA MIB data

CNS Publish and Subscribe BusCNS Publish and Subscribe BusCNS Publish and Subscribe Bus

MIB data

Third-PartyNetFlow Collector

NetFlow Data

21© 2004 Cisco Systems, Inc. All rights reserved.

MPLS MIBs

MPLS-LSR-STD MIB, MPLS-TE-STD MIB, MPLS-FTN-STD MIB, MPLS-LDP-STD MIB, MPLS-TC-STD MIB

IETF StandardsIETF Standards

• MPLS, MPLS-VPN, MPLS-TEApplicationsApplications

• MIBs: LDP, LSR-MIB, TE-MIB, PPVPN-MPLS-VPN-MIB, PWE3-MPLS-MIB, MPLS-FRR-MIBSolutionSolution

• Standards-based SNMP implementation• Integration with existing OSS and third-party vendors/software

RequirementRequirement

222222© 2004 Cisco Systems, Inc. All rights reserved.

Cisco Info Center: VPN Policy Manager 3.1

• Cisco Info Center VPNPolicy Manager (Cisco InfoCenter and IP SolutionCenter integration)correlates network eventsto affected services

• CIC VPN Policy Manageravailable today

• Cisco Info Center VPNPolicy Manager 3.1 offers:

• New Cisco Info Center VPNPolicy Manager DSAdeveloped

• New Cisco Info Center VPNPolicy Manager policiesdeveloped

• Device/Interface/Sub-interfaceMPLS VPN subscribercorrelation

• MPLS troubleshooting tools

Cisco Info CenterMPLS TroubleShooting Tools

232323© 2004 Cisco Systems, Inc. All rights reserved.

Agenda

• Introduction• Technology Overview• Summary

© 2004 Cisco Systems, Inc. All rights reserved.

Summary

• Provide systemic,integrated, andinnovativemanageability solutions

• Standards-based openinterfaces for easier andfaster integration

• Complete end-to-endMPLS service andnetwork managementsolutions

Intelligence

Automation SimplificationProductivityROI/TCO

24

252525© 2004 Cisco Systems, Inc. All rights reserved.

Cisco leads in the MPLS Market

Americas EMEA AsiaPac/Japan

EBTKorea

Telecom

Over 200 Customers (MPLS Core & L2/L3 Edge)

25© 2004 Cisco Systems, Inc. All rights reserved.

262626© 2004 Cisco Systems, Inc. All rights reserved.

FasterA flexible QoS frameworkto enable migration to aconverged infrastructure

FasterFasterA flexible QoS frameworkA flexible QoS frameworkto enable migration to ato enable migration to aconverged infrastructureconverged infrastructure

LastingExtensibility to different

transports with standards-based open architecturefor investment protection

LastingLastingExtensibility to differentExtensibility to different

transports with standards-transports with standards-based open architecturebased open architecturefor investment protectionfor investment protection

SmarterThe foundation for more

services and morerevenues

SmarterSmarterThe foundation for moreThe foundation for more

services and moreservices and morerevenuesrevenues

Cisco IOS MPLS

26

Enabling

Innovative

Services

Enabling

Innovative

Services

© 2004 Cisco Systems, Inc. All rights reserved.

272727© 2004 Cisco Systems, Inc. All rights reserved.

Recommended